Ambassador of Republic of Kazakhstan to Pakistan Yerzhan Kistafin met with Mukhtar Ahmed, Chairman of the Higher Education Commission (HEC) of Pakistan, DKNews.kz reports.

As part of the work carried out to strengthen and diversify cooperation between Kazakhstan and Pakistan, Yerzhan Kistafin especially highlighted the field of education.

The Ambassador spoke about the measures taken to establish interaction between higher educational institutions of the two countries, stating the advisability of involving authorized institutions of Kazakhstan and Pakistan in this work.

The Chairman of the HEC informed about the policy of the Government of Pakistan in the field of higher education, aimed at improving the quality and establishing interaction with foreign partners.

According to Mukhtar Ahmed, cooperation between universities can also facilitate joint research projects, bringing a qualitatively new level of partnership in the field of science.

During the meeting Ambassador invited the Chairman of the Commission together with the heads of Pakistani universities to visit Kazakhstan to hold talks with the Ministry of Science and Higher Education of Kazakhstan, educational institutions to form a favourable institutional environment and identify promising areas of cooperation.

As a result of the event, an agreement was reached to organize in the near future negotiations between the Higher Education Commission of Pakistan and the Ministry of Science and Higher Education of Kazakhstan.
